To calculate:

The ratio of an elongated cell that measures 125×1×1 arbitrary units. Predict how its surface to volume ratio would compare with reference to the Figure 4.6 “Geometric relationships”, in the textbook.

Introduction:

Surface to volume ratio is also called as surface area to volume ratio and it is denoted by SA:V. The ratio is the “amount of surface area per unit volume of object”.
